Why Use a Period Tracker App?

Using a period tracker app can bring numerous benefits to your menstrual health and overall well-being. These apps can help you understand your menstrual cycle, track your fertility window, and anticipate symptoms like cramps, mood swings, and PMS (premenstrual syndrome) episodes. By staying informed, you can improve your relationships, make informed decisions about birth control, and plan for pregnancy or fertility treatments. In the words of Dr. Stacy T. Sims, a sports scientist who specializes in women's health: "Knowing your menstrual cycle can be a powerful tool for optimizing your physical and mental performance."

Key Features to Consider

When choosing a period tracker app, consider the following key features to ensure it meets your needs:

  • Fertility tracking and ovulation prediction: Look for apps that use advanced algorithms and machine learning to predict your fertile window.
  • Customizable charts and calendar views: Ensure the app offers a user-friendly interface that allows you to visualize your cycle in a way that works for you.
  • Symptom tracking: Choose an app that allows you to track and log your symptoms, such as cramps, mood swings, and PMS episodes.
  • Integration with wearable devices and health apps: Consider apps that can integrate with popular health and fitness apps, like Fitbit and Google Fit.
  • Birth control method support: Look for apps that support your birth control method and provide personalized recommendations.
